Output 0269313b4e117e3c2abfac2f4cd3798ea3179176cd7a32af819362f1866177aa:0

value
1075496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ab560f149e13a78038425eae6551bd7b367c9f8 OP_EQUAL
address
3ELSTRnNPbiPGw8j5QYp9xM8GB62n54smY
transaction
0269313b4e117e3c2abfac2f4cd3798ea3179176cd7a32af819362f1866177aa
spent
true